

Napranum Aboriginal Shire Council, located in Napranum, a meeting place for approximately 883 Indigenous people, is dedicated to serving the community and providing essential services to its residents. Situated on the western side of the Cape York Peninsula, 819 kilometres northwest of Cairns, Napranum is a vibrant community with a rich cultural heritage.

Napranum is home to Indigenous people from as many as 40 different groups from around Cape York Peninsula. This diversity adds to the richness of the community, creating a unique and inclusive environment.
